About the Role
This is a high-impact senior leadership position at the heart of Radiology. You will:
Lead and develop Radiography and Diagnostics services across the Trust
Champion innovation, service transformation, and continuous improvement
Drive high-quality, patient-centred care and safety
Provide professional leadership and a strong voice for radiographers locally and across the ICS
Oversee performance, governance, workforce strategy, and financial stewardship
Act as the Trust’s lead for radiation protection and IR(ME)R compliance
Working closely with senior clinical and operational leaders, you’ll ensure our services remain high-performing, sustainable, and forward-looking, delivering outstanding care every day.

What You’ll Bring
We’re looking for a confident, forward-thinking leader who can inspire teams and deliver change. You will have:
HCPC registration and a degree in Radiography
Significant experience leading Radiology services and driving transformation
Strong knowledge of clinical standards, governance, and NHS policy
Proven ability to lead teams through change and deliver performance
Excellent communication, influencing, and strategic thinking skills
You’ll be passionate about developing people, improving services, and creating a culture where staff feel empowered, supported, and engaged.
